Handover note — Seat-map renderer, Pelloway Theatre project

For the weekly sync: the SVG seat-map renderer is stable; zoom clustering and accessibility overlays shipped last sprint. Remaining work is the balcony tier layout edge case and the color-blind palette review. Test fixtures are in the shared repo. From this week, questions and review requests should go to the engineer taking over, named below.

account owner for bawip-tahag: Raleth Quenok

Ticket: Config drift on the Haldane garage occupancy feed. The Ostermill node is publishing counts every 5s while the other three garages publish every 15s, which skews the aggregation window downstream in Lotgrid. Someone hot-patched the interval during the holiday surge and never reverted. Please review the diff and restore parity across all nodes. The intended baseline configuration is as follows.

settings of kahip-hafop:
ralix:
  log_level: warn
  metrics_host: metrics.ralix.zemvarsys.internal
  pin: 8273
  pool_size: 8

## Break-Glass: Telemetry Compression (Squeezebox)

Quick note for the sync: if the Squeezebox compressor wedges and payloads back up, you can force passthrough mode from the ops panel. Don't leave it on overnight — storage costs spike. The panel's break-glass switch needs the recovery passphrase, which for reference is:

vault phrase of bagaf-kajeg = jorath-feniel-briir-siliel-ralix